Thinkpads *used to* use their sound system (MWave) for the modem (they
are technically the same idea, just for different purposes) - not sure
if that is still the case, but if it is, it is tremendously different
from most any other winmodem.

That said, I've heard people complain about trying to install *anything*
on individual Thinkpads over the years - from IBM PC-DOS 6.1 and OS/2
through most Windows releases and the like - some have *very*
non-standard hardware configurations.
